脉冲激光辐射下VO_2薄膜的光限幅性能

摘    要:采用反应溅射和后续退火工艺,在石英衬底上制备具有热致相变特性的VO_2薄膜,并对薄膜的光学性能进行表征。研究发现:在弱光辐射下,随着温度的改变,薄膜的透射率在可见及近红外光区会发生显著变化,具有良好的相变光开关特性;在强光辐射下,制备的VO_2薄膜同样具有良好的红外光调制深度;当脉冲激光波长为1064 nm时,随着脉冲能量的逐渐增强,薄膜的表面反射率逐渐降低,光限幅性能呈现出先升高再降低的趋势,其透射率最低可降至7%,薄膜的脉冲激光损伤阈值约为50 mJ/cm~2。

关 键 词:VO2  热致相变  激光防护

Anti-laser Irradiation Ability of VO2 Films Against Pulsed Power Laser

Abstract:Thermochromic VO2 film was fabricated on quartz substrate through sputtering oxidation coupling method,and its optical properties were also investigated.Results show that the prepared VO2 film exhibits good thermo-optical switching performance under weak light irradiation,while large transmittance changes both in the visible and near-infrared light area.Under the condition of pulsed power laser irratiating,large optical modulation depth is also derived in the infra-red region.With the increase of pulsed laser energy,the scattering coefficient is gradually decreased,and the anti-laser irradiation ability is firstly appeared to have a decline trend after an initial ascent.The minimum transmittance value can reach to 7% and the laser damage threshold is about 50 mJ/cm2.
Keywords:VO2  thermochromism  laser protection
